Назад | Перейти на главную страницу

Не удается получить файлы из CPAN

Я пытаюсь загрузить модули из CPAN, но не получается

что-то не так с моей конфигурацией CPAN, я не могу понять, что

cpan> install Bundle::CPAN 
CPAN: Storable loaded ok
CPAN: LWP::UserAgent loaded ok
Fetching with LWP:
  ftp://cpan.rinet.ru/pub/mirror/CPAN/authors/01mailrc.txt.gz
LWP failed with code[404] message[File '01mailrc.txt.gz' not found]
Fetching with Net::FTP:
  ftp://cpan.rinet.ru/pub/mirror/CPAN/authors/01mailrc.txt.gz
Couldn't fetch 01mailrc.txt.gz from cpan.rinet.ru
Fetching with LWP:
  ftp://cpan.makeperl.org/pub/CPAN/authors/01mailrc.txt.gz
Useless content call in void context at /usr/share/perl5/LWP/Protocol/ftp.pm line 398
LWP failed with code[400] message[FTP return code 000]

файл ftp://cpan.rinet.ru/pub/mirror/CPAN/authors/01mailrc.txt.gz существуют

РЕДАКТИРОВАТЬ: проблема заключалась в том, что некоторые серверы не позволяют получать файлы по ftp (ncftpget работает нормально) обнаружил сервер, который позволяет

Мне кажется, что файл не существует на этом FTP-сервере. FTP в него и посмотрите, есть ли он там и как выглядят разрешения. Возможно, вам понадобится новое зеркало.

из оболочки CPAN используйте 'o conf urllist', 'o conf urllist shift' и 'o conf urllist push http: // somenewmirror'команды.

Или "o conf init" для выполнения начальной настройки.

Или найдите файл CPAN / Config.pm (другой, если он хранится в вашем домашнем каталоге) и отредактируйте список прямо там.

(большая часть этого ответа была найдена на http://mail.pm.org/pipermail/spug-list/2005-May/006520.html после бега http://www.google.com/search?sourceid=chrome&ie=UTF-8&q=LWP+failed+with+code[404] ]message[File+'01mailrc.txt.gz' + не + найдено])